Materials Data on NaPr2Cl6 by Materials Project
Abstract
NaPr2Cl6 crystallizes in the trigonal P-3 space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Na is bonded in a 6-coordinate geometry to six equivalent Cl atoms. All Na–Cl bond lengths are 2.96 Å. Pr is bonded in a 9-coordinate geometry to nine equivalent Cl atoms. There are six shorter (2.93 Å) and three longer (3.13 Å) Pr–Cl bond lengths. Cl is bonded to one Na and three equivalent Pr atoms to form a mixture of edge and corner-sharing ClNaPr3 tetrahedra.
